    Hi all,

    We need to deliver 26 episodes of a US show to the Middle East. I’ve been able to get the video converted well using Compressor or AME but I’m having a terrible time getting the audio specs correct. They are requesting two stereo tracks (Full Mix/M&E) embedded at 24bit/48k Big Endian. I can get FCP7 to export with the audio tracks embedded but it they always end up at 16 bit/48 little endian. Using Compressor OR AME just seems to always merge the two stereo tracks together. Any advice on how I can accomplish?

    EDITING SPECS
    DVCPRO HD 1080i60, 29.97, 16bit/48k

    DELIVERY SPECS
    Video: QuickTime Movie (*.mov)
    Compression: Apple ProRes 422 (HQ)
    Quality: Best
    Frame rate: 25 fps
    Scan Mode: Interlaced
    Aspect Ratio: 16:9 1.78
    Dimensions: 1920 x 1080
    Field Dominance: Upper Field First
    Sound:
    Format Integer (Big Endian)
    Sample rate: 48.000kHz
    Sample size: 24-bit
    Channels: 1/2ch Stereo MIX
    3/4ch Stereo M&E

    Go into the Sequence Settings, and in the lower right of the GENERAL Tab, change the depth from 16 bit to 24bit, and the Config to Discreet.
